    Frequently Asked Questions

    Vanguard says the fund is suitable for buy and hold investors seeking long-term capital growth, some income, international diversification, and with a higher tolerance for the risks associated with share market volatility.

    The Vanguard MSCI Index International Shares ETF listed on the ASX on 9 June 1997.

    Yes, the fund pays quarterly distributions.

    Vanguard MSCI International Shares ETF distributions are historically paid in January, April, July, and October.

    Mr Daniel Shrimski Non-Executive Director May 2021
    Mr Shrimski is the Managing Director of Vanguard Australia. In this role, Daniel is responsible for all aspects of the management, distribution, and operation of Vanguard's Australian business. Most recently, he was CFO of Vanguard's International business and a member of the International Leadership Team. Daniel has financial services experience in both Australia and the U.S. Prior to Vanguard, he spent 11 years at GE across Australia, the U.S. and the Netherlands where, amongst other roles, he was a Finance Director within GE Capital Australia's consumer finance division.
    Mr Curt Jacques Non-Executive Director Jan 2022
    Mr Jacques is the Head of Risk Management at Vanguard Australia and a member of the executive leadership team. In this role, Curt is responsible for overseeing and improving Vanguard's risk capability to support a continued focus on serving individual investors and their advisors. Curt has spent the majority of his nearly 20-year career in risk roles at PricewaterhouseCoopers (PwC), and most recently at Macquarie Group. At Macquarie, Curt was responsible for leading a risk transformation program to enhance risk frameworks and systems across all lines of defence. During his time at PwC, Curt worked with asset managers and global banks to enhance their risk programs and frameworks.
    Ms Kim Petersen Non-Executive Director Jan 2022
    Ms Petersen is Chief Information Officer, International Division for Vanguard. In this role, Kim is responsible for the delivery of technology solutions for Vanguard's international businesses, as well as IT governance, innovation, and technology strategy. Prior to commencing this role in September 2021, Kim was CIO, Asia Pacific for Vanguard Australia. Kim has over 20 years of Information Technology experience in roles held across the automotive industry. Before joining Vanguard, Kim was IT Infrastructure and Operations Manager at Jetstar Australia where she led the teams in charge of end user computing, service management, data centre and cloud, networks, and cyber security operations.
